CHARLOTTE – A pair of first-year lacrosse programs are set to meet on Friday night at Jerry Richardson Stadium as Charlotte (5-7, 0-3 AAC) hosts league-leading South Florida (9-2, 3-0) for a 6 p.m. first draw.
Admission to the game is free.
The Niners have opened their conference slate against the heart of the league's roster and will seek their first conference victory against a program on a six-game winning streak in South Florida. The 49ers enter the contest boasting one of the nation's top scoring offenses at 14.8 points per game (18th nationally) and the second-ranked offense in the AAC.
